Skip to content

Commit 2b4c361

Browse files
author
clowwindy
committed
reorder setsid and kill
1 parent dae2624 commit 2b4c361

File tree

1 file changed

+3
-3
lines changed

1 file changed

+3
-3
lines changed

shadowsocks/daemon.py

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-123,12 +123,12 @@ def handle_exit(signum, _):
123123
os.kill(ppid, signal.SIGINT)
124124
sys.exit(1)
125125

126-
print('started')
127-
os.kill(ppid, signal.SIGTERM)
128-
129126
os.setsid()
130127
signal.signal(signal.SIG_IGN, signal.SIGHUP)
131128

129+
print('started')
130+
os.kill(ppid, signal.SIGTERM)
131+
132132
sys.stdin.close()
133133
try:
134134
freopen(log_file, 'a', sys.stdout)

0 commit comments

Comments
 (0)